Common Easypdfreader.exe Errors on Windows

Encountering errors associated with easypdfreader.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to easypdfreader.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.

  • Easypdfreader.exe has Stopped Working: This warning is displayed when the system detects that the executable file is no longer performing as expected. This can be caused by software errors, interference from other applications, or system resource limitations.
  • Blue Screen of Death (BSOD): This error message is displayed when the system encounters a severe error that causes it to crash. This could be due to hardware issues, driver conflicts, or severe software bugs that affect the operating system's stability.
  • Error 0xc0000142: This error is often encountered when a user tries to initialize a Microsoft Windows application and the system fails to initialize easypdfreader.exe correctly.
  • Application Not Found: This error can arise when the easypdfreader.exe file has been moved, deleted, or is not properly associated with the program it belongs to.
  • Error 0xc0000005: This error message is shown when there is an access violation issue, commonly due to memory problems, malware infection, or outdated drivers.

How to Remove Easypdfreader.exe

Should you need to remove the easypdfreader.exe file from your system, please proceed with the following steps. As always, exercise caution when modifying system files, as inadvertent changes can sometimes lead to unexpected system behavior.

  1. Identify the file location: The first step is to find where easypdfreader.exe resides on your computer. You can do this by right-clicking the file (if visible) and choosing Properties or searching for it in the File Explorer.

  2. Backup your data: Before making any changes, ensure you have a backup of important data. This way, if something goes wrong, you can restore your data.

  3. Delete the file: Once you've located easypdfreader.exe, right-click on it and select Delete. This will move the file to the Recycle Bin.

  4. Empty the Recycle Bin: After deleting easypdfreader.exe, don't forget to empty the Recycle Bin to remove the file from your system completely. Right-click on the Recycle Bin and select Empty Recycle Bin.

  5. Scan your system: After removing the file, running a full system scan with a trusted antivirus tool is a good idea. This will help ensure no leftover file pieces or other potential threats.

Note: Remember, if easypdfreader.exe is part of a sprogram, removing this file may affect the application's functionality. If issues arise after the deletion, consider reinstalling the software or seek assistance from a tech professional.
